Record and development:
On-line poker emerged in the late 1990s as a consequence of developments in technology in addition to net. The very first on-line poker space,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ate community. However, it was in early 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ential growth, primarily as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Popularity and Accessibility:
One of many good reasons for the immense popularity of on-line poker is its availability. People can log on to their favorite on-line poker systems at any time, from everywhere, employing their computer systems or mobile phones. This convenience features attracted a varied player base, ranging from recreational people to specialists, adding to the rapid development of internet poker.

Challenges and Regulation:
Even though the internet poker business flourishes, it faces difficulties by means of regulation and safety issues. Governing bodies worldwide have actually implemented differing degrees of legislation to protect people preventing deceptive activities. Furthermore, online poker systems require powerful safety measures to guard players' private and financial information, ensuring a safe playing environment.
